The problem was caused by there being a default sim pin already set. The actual solution which I gathered by talking to Doro tech help, Vodafone LiveChat and visiting the local Vodafone store is:-
Open the phone > menu > settings > security >simlock>on; at this point the sim default pin Number must be entered, this is 0000 for a Vodafone Sim. It is all quite straightforward after that.
